Why These Are the Top Home Solar Contractors in Maysville

** The home solar market in and around Maysville, Arkansas, is characteristic of a growing rural and suburban market. While Maysville itself has no dedicated solar installers, it is well within the service area of several top-tier regional companies based in the economic hubs of Northwest Arkansas (like Bentonville, Rogers, and Fayetteville). The competition among these providers is strong, leading to high-quality service and competitive pricing. The average quality of installers is high, with companies holding certifications from major manufacturers (like SunPower, Tesla, and Panasonic) and adhering to professional standards. Typical pricing for a residential system in Arkansas ranges from **$2.50 to $3.50 per watt** before incentives. For an average 8 kW system, this translates to a gross cost of $20,000 - $28,000. However, the federal Investment Tax Credit (ITC) can reduce this cost by 30%, and Arkansas's net metering policies provide additional long-term savings. Providers in this region are generally very knowledgeable about these state and federal incentives, which they use to structure attractive financing and leasing options for homeowners.

1What is the average cost of a home solar system in Maysville, AR, and are there any local incentives?

For a typical Maysville home, a solar panel system costs between $15,000 to $25,000 before incentives, depending on system size and energy needs. Arkansas offers a state tax credit of 30% of the system cost (capped at $1,000) in addition to the 30% federal tax credit. While there are no specific Maysville or Benton County incentives, homeowners should also check with their local utility, likely Ozarks Electric Cooperative, for any net metering or rebate programs.

4How long does the entire process take from signing a contract to turning the system on in Maysville?

From contract to activation, the process typically takes 2 to 4 months. This timeline includes system design, securing permits from Benton County, ordering equipment, the physical installation (1-3 days), and the final inspection and interconnection approval from your utility. Delays can occur during the utility's interconnection review, so working with an experienced local installer is key.

5I'm concerned about power outages. Will my solar panels work if the grid goes down?

Standard grid-tied solar systems automatically shut off during a grid outage for safety, meaning you will not have power. To have backup power during outages common in Arkansas storms, you must install a solar battery storage system (like a Tesla Powerwall or similar) or a special inverter that can isolate your home from the grid. Discuss this critical upgrade with your installer during the initial design phase.
